Understanding the FirstEnergy Stadium Seating Map Basics

Before diving into the specifics, it’s crucial to grasp the fundamental layout of FirstEnergy Stadium. Think of the stadium as a layered cake, with different levels offering varying perspectives and experiences. You’ll find the Lower Level, closest to the action; the Upper Level, providing a broader view; exclusive Club Seats with premium amenities; and luxurious Suites for a truly special experience.

The sections within each level are organized logically. Generally, section numbers increase as you move further away from the center of the field. Imagine the fifty-yard line as the epicenter – the sections nearest to this point will have the lowest numbers. The even-numbered sections are typically found on one side of the field (often the west side), while the odd-numbered sections reside on the opposite side (usually the east side). Keep this pattern in mind when searching for seats in specific sections.

Within each section, rows are typically numbered sequentially, starting closest to the field. Row designations often begin with “Row A,” “Row B,” or a similar alpha-numeric system. As you move further back in the section, the row letters or numbers will increase accordingly.

Seat numbers within a row also follow a consistent pattern. Typically, seat number one will be on the left as you face the field, with numbers increasing sequentially as you move to the right. Armed with this basic understanding, you can start to pinpoint potential seating options with greater accuracy.

Lower Level Seats: Feel the Roar

For those who want to be as close to the action as possible, the Lower Level seats are the ultimate choice. Imagine feeling the thunderous footsteps of the players, witnessing every tackle and pass up close, and being immersed in the raw energy of the game.

The advantages of the Lower Level are undeniable: unparalleled proximity to the field, an intense atmosphere, and a feeling of being right in the heart of the action. However, this premium experience comes at a cost. Lower Level seats are typically the most expensive in the stadium, and in some sections, your view of the entire field might be somewhat limited.

Specifically, consider sections closer to the corners of the end zones. While these seats offer a fantastic view of the goal line, you might miss some of the action unfolding on the opposite side of the field. However, sections along the sidelines, especially those between the twenty-yard lines, provide an excellent balance of proximity and overall field visibility.

Upper Level Seats: A Panoramic View

If you’re seeking a more affordable option without sacrificing a great view, the Upper Level seats are an excellent choice. From this vantage point, you’ll enjoy a panoramic perspective of the entire field, allowing you to see plays develop and appreciate the overall game strategy.

The Upper Level offers several benefits: it’s generally more budget-friendly than the Lower Level, provides a wider field view, and often has shorter lines for concessions and restrooms. However, keep in mind that you’ll be further from the action, and some sections may be more exposed to the elements, such as wind or rain.

When choosing Upper Level seats, consider sections located near the center of the field. These sections tend to offer the best balance of height and angle, providing a clear and unobstructed view of the entire playing surface. Also, try to avoid sections directly behind the goalposts, as these might have slightly obstructed views.

The Dawg Pound: Unleash Your Inner Fanatic

No discussion of FirstEnergy Stadium seating is complete without mentioning the legendary Dawg Pound. Located in the east end zone, the Dawg Pound is home to the most passionate and raucous Browns fans in the stadium.

Imagine being surrounded by a sea of orange and brown, chanting and cheering alongside thousands of fellow fanatics. The Dawg Pound is an experience unlike any other – a true testament to the unwavering loyalty of Browns fans.

However, be warned: the Dawg Pound is not for the faint of heart. It’s a high-energy, standing-room-only section where things can get pretty wild. If you’re looking for a more relaxed or family-friendly experience, the Dawg Pound might not be the best choice. But if you’re ready to unleash your inner fanatic and immerse yourself in the ultimate Browns atmosphere, the Dawg Pound is an experience you won’t soon forget.
